SHANGHAI, Apr. 14 (SMM) - The Weihai port of Shandong Province imported 7941 tonnes of heavy metal concentrate worth $16.22 million in the first quarter of 2017, local paper reported.

Most of those shipments were lead concentrate and copper concentrate, mainly imported from Ecuador, Peru, Mexico and Iran.

Weihai has improved inspection efficiency and helped reduce logistics cost.
